Notes:
1) Exceeding these ratings may damage the device.
2) The maximum allowable power dissipation is a function of the
maximum junction temperature T
J
(MAX), the junction-to-
ambient thermal resistance
JA
, and the ambient temperature
T
A
. The maximum allowable continuous power dissipation at
any ambient temperature is calculated by P
D
(MAX)=(T
J
(MAX)-
T
A
)/
JA
. Exceeding the maximum allowable power dissipation
will cause excessive die temperature, and the regulator will go
into thermal shutdown. Internal thermal shutdown circuitry
protects the device from permanent damage.
3) The device is not guaranteed to function outside of its
operating conditions.
4) Measured on JESD51-7 4-layer board.
